Getting Started: Optimizing Strategic Partnerships

Many of your requests for resources will be granted by appealing to a desire to give to a worthwhile community effort. However, contributions from your response partners should be considered an exchange. You are providing them something valuable as a committed volunteer corps.

In exchange for what your MRC might offer their organizations, your response partners may be willing to offer:

  • Training (free or low cost)
  • Access to legal and other expertise
  • Access to office space or other administrative resources
  • Credentials verification or background checks for volunteers

The more others see the benefit of your volunteers, the more they will see what they are receiving in return.

Your partners will appreciate recognition for their contributions. It is appropriate to include their names on your brochures, newsletters, or other forms of public communication. When you recognize your partners’ contributions, it shows that you appreciate their efforts and informs the community of your partners’ good stewardship.
